I don't know, but this sounds a little like the two films made by Channel 4 in the 1980s. They were called Walter (1982) and Walter and June (1986). The star was Sir Ian McKellen, playing the title character - Sarah Miles was June. Walter had mental health issues, and certainly wore a flat cap and boots. He also kept pigeons. Euryale. |

I think you're referring to Horace (1982) with Barry Jackson from Midsomer in the title role, but this was a series, not a single drama.
Can't find much on it, but didn't he work in a toy factory? IIRC, he would preface any words of wisdom with, "Mam says......." I have vague memories of some yobs chucking him int' canal in one episode. Good performance from Jackson as the gentle man-child. |
